Termination of Agreement: <br /> A. Refer to Base Contract. <br /> <br />VI.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A): <br /> <br /> A. The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) provides that alterations to a facility must be made in such a <br /> manner that, to the maximum extent feasible, the altered portions of the facility are readily accessible to <br /> and by individuals with disabilities. The Client acknowledges that the requirements of the ADA will be <br /> subject to various and possibly contradictory interpretations. The Architect, therefore, will use its best <br /> professional efforts to interpret applicable ADA requirements and other federal, state and local laws, <br /> roles, codes, ordinances and regulations as they apply to the ADA portions of the Project. The Architect, <br /> however, cannot and does not warranty or guarantee that the Project will comply with all interpretations <br /> of the ADA requirements and~or the requirements of other federal, state and local laws, roles, codes, <br /> ordinances and regulations as they apply to the ADA portions of this project. <br /> <br />VII. Remodeling/Rehabilitation: <br /> <br /> A. The Client understands and acknowledges that in the remodeling or rehabilitation of existing structures, <br /> certain design and technical decisions are made on assumptions based upon readily available documents <br /> and visual observation of existing conditions. Unless specifically directed in writing by the Client, the <br /> Architect shall not perform or have performed any destructive testing or open any concealed portions of <br /> the building in order to ascertain its actual condition. <br /> <br />VIII. Information Provided by Client: <br /> A. The Architect shall indicate to the Client the information needed for rendering of services hereunder. The <br /> Client shall provide to the Architect such information as is available to the Client and the Client's <br /> consultants and contractors, and the Architect shall be entitled to rely upon the accuracy and <br /> completeness thereof. The Client recognizes that it is impossible for the Architect to assure the accuracy, <br /> completeness and sufficiency of such information, either because it is impossible to verify, or because of <br /> errors or omissions which may have occurred in assembling the information the Client is providing. <br /> <br /> EXHIBIT A <br /> <br /> <br />
